## Error architecture

### Error hierarchy

All SDK errors inherit from `BaseSdkException`, providing a consistent structure:

```kotlin
open class BaseSdkException(
    message: String,
    cause: Throwable? = null,
    val errorCode: String
) : Exception(message, cause)
```

### Error categories

The SDK organises errors into logical categories with standardised codes:

```kotlin
object SdkErrorCodes {
    // 00: Common Errors
    const val UNEXPECTED_ERROR = "SDK0000"
    const val NOT_IMPLEMENTED = "SDK0001"
    const val VALIDATION_ERROR = "SDK0002"
    
    // 01: SDK Errors
    const val SDK_CONFIG_EMPTY = "SDK0100"
    const val SDK_CONFIG_ENVIRONMENT_EMPTY = "SDK0101"
    const val SDK_CONFIG_SESSION_EMPTY = "SDK0102"
    
    // 02: Component Errors
    const val COMPONENT_ERROR = "SDK0200"
    const val COMPONENT_CONFIG_NAME_EMPTY = "SDK0201"
    const val COMPONENT_CONTAINER_NOT_FOUND = "SDK0202"
    
    // 03: Token Vault Errors
    const val TOKEN_VAULT_ERROR = "SDK0300"
    const val TOKENIZE_CARD_ERROR = "SDK0301"
    const val RETRIEVE_TOKENS_ERROR = "SDK0302"
    
    // 04: ThreeDSecure Errors
    const val AUTHENTICATION_FAILED = "SDK0505"
    const val PRE_INITIATE_INTEGRATED_AUTHENTICATION_CURRENCY_CODE_INVALID = "SDK0400"
    
    // 05: Transaction Errors
    const val NETWORK_ERROR = "SDK0500"
    const val VALIDATION_ERROR = "SDK0501"
    const val PARSE_ERROR = "SDK0502"
}
```

## Implementation patterns

### Centralised error handling

Create a central error handler for consistent error management:

```kotlin
class PxpErrorHandler {
    
    fun handleError(error: Throwable) {
        val baseSdkException = when (error) {
            is BaseSdkException -> error
            is Exception -> {
                if (error.message == "NetWorkError") {
                    NetworkSdkException(error)
                } else {
                    UnexpectedSdkException(error)
                }
            }
            else -> UnexpectedSdkException(error)
        }
        
        when (baseSdkException) {
            is ComponentValidationException -> ValidationErrorHandler().handleValidationError(baseSdkException)
            is AuthenticationFailedException -> ThreeDSErrorHandler().handleAuthenticationError(baseSdkException)
            is ComponentException -> ComponentErrorHandler().handleComponentError(baseSdkException)
            else -> handleGenericError(baseSdkException)
        }
        
        // Track error for analytics
        trackError(baseSdkException)
    }
    
    private fun handleGenericError(exception: BaseSdkException) {
        Log.e("PxpError", "Generic error: ${exception.message} (${exception.errorCode})")
        showError("An error occurred. Please try again.")
    }
    
    private fun trackError(exception: BaseSdkException) {
        // Track error for analytics and monitoring
        analytics.track("payment_error", mapOf(
            "error_code" to exception.errorCode,
            "error_message" to exception.message,
            "error_type" to exception::class.simpleName
        ))
    }
}
```

### Retry mechanisms

Implement intelligent retry logic for transient failures:

```kotlin
class PaymentRetryManager {
    private var retryCount = 0
    private val maxRetries = 3
    private val retryDelays = listOf(1000L, 2000L, 5000L) // Progressive delays
    
    fun handleRetryableError(error: BaseSdkException, retryAction: () -> Unit) {
        if (shouldRetry(error) && retryCount < maxRetries) {
            val delay = retryDelays.getOrElse(retryCount) { 5000L }
            retryCount++
            
            Log.w("Retry", "Retrying operation in ${delay}ms (attempt $retryCount/$maxRetries)")
            showRetryMessage("Retrying... (${retryCount}/$maxRetries)")
            
            // Delay and retry
            Handler(Looper.getMainLooper()).postDelayed({
                retryAction()
            }, delay)
        } else {
            // Max retries reached or non-retryable error
            retryCount = 0
            handleFinalFailure(error)
        }
    }
    
    private fun shouldRetry(error: BaseSdkException): Boolean {
        return when (error.errorCode) {
            ErrorCode.NETWORK_ERROR,
            ErrorCode.TIMEOUT_ERROR,
            ErrorCode.HTTP_ERROR -> true
            else -> false
        }
    }
    
    private fun handleFinalFailure(error: BaseSdkException) {
        Log.e("Retry", "Max retries reached for error: ${error.message}")
        showError("Unable to complete payment after multiple attempts. Please try again later.")
    }
    
    fun resetRetryCount() {
        retryCount = 0
    }
}
```

## Error recovery strategies

### Graceful degradation

Implement fallback options when primary payment methods fail:

```kotlin
class PaymentFlowManager {
    
    fun handlePaymentFailure(error: BaseSdkException) {
        when (error.errorCode) {
            SdkErrorCodes.TOKENIZE_CARD_ERROR -> {
                // Fallback to direct payment without tokenisation
                Log.w("PaymentFlow", "Tokenisation failed, proceeding without saving card")
                showOption("Payment method won't be saved for future use. Continue?") {
                    proceedWithDirectPayment()
                }
            }
            "SDK0505" -> { // 3DS authentication failed
                // Fallback to non-3DS if supported
                Log.w("PaymentFlow", "3DS failed, attempting non-3DS payment")
                showOption("Authentication failed. Try simplified payment?") {
                    proceedWithNon3DSPayment()
                }
            }
            SdkErrorCodes.RETRIEVE_TOKENS_ERROR -> {
                // Fallback to new card entry
                Log.w("PaymentFlow", "Saved cards unavailable, using new card flow")
                showNewCardForm()
            }
            else -> {
                // Generic retry option
                showRetryOption("Payment failed. Would you like to try again?") {
                    retryPayment()
                }
            }
        }
    }
}
```

### Progressive error handling

Implement escalating error handling based on failure count:

```kotlin
class ProgressiveErrorHandler {
    private var consecutiveFailures = 0
    
    fun handleError(error: BaseSdkException) {
        consecutiveFailures++
        
        when (consecutiveFailures) {
            1 -> {
                // First failure: Simple retry
                showSimpleRetry("Payment failed. Please try again.")
            }
            2 -> {
                // Second failure: Suggest checking details
                showDetailedRetry("Payment failed again. Please check your card details and try again.")
            }
            3 -> {
                // Third failure: Offer alternative payment methods
                showAlternativeOptions("Multiple payment failures. Would you like to try a different payment method?")
            }
            else -> {
                // Multiple failures: Suggest contacting support
                showSupportOption("We're having trouble processing your payment. Please contact support for assistance.")
            }
        }
    }
    
    fun resetFailureCount() {
        consecutiveFailures = 0
    }
}
```
